What happens in this class?

Have you ever wanted to design & make a piece of your own jewellery? Do you want to gift a unique piece of jewellery to someone close to you? Or do you just want to learn a new skill?

Join me in my workshop in the heart of the Kent countryside for a personal tuition jewellery-making workshop and I’ll help you create something completely unique to take home at the end of the workshop.

My workshop experiences also make an ideal birthday, anniversary, wedding or Christmas gift, as well as an unusual, stag/hen or corporate team-building event…

Things to remember

Practical clothing should be worn, for example, no long loose sleeves, no dangling jewellery & no open toed shoes or high heels. Long hair must be tied back to avoid catching in machinery or gas flames.

Workshop Personal Protection Equipment, apart from footwear and an apron, is provided.

Your Teacher

Sara is a Silversmith based in Kent, specialising in hand crafted, bespoke silverware, jewellery and workshop experiences and teaching sessions.
